A literature survey of the main aspects of the polymerization of olefins using homogeneous and silica, alumina and niobia supported metallocene catalyst systems is presented. Fundamental information about the surface of niobia and its use as a catalyst support is included. A study of kinetics of polymerization of ethylene was conducted using homogeneous bis(cyclopentadienyl)zirconium dichloride-MAO catalyst systems and its silica, alumina and niobia supported analogue catalyst systems. The characterization of the polyethylene produced by such catalyst systems, focussing on the molecular weight distribution, melting behaviour and morphology of the polymer was carried out.
